Product Management Improvement Question: Enhancing data visualization tool user interface for intuitive use

Introduction

Thank you for presenting this challenge. To enhance the user interface of SystemOne's data visualization tool and make it more intuitive, we'll need to dive deep into user needs, pain points, and potential solutions. I'll walk you through my approach, starting with clarifying questions, then moving on to user segmentation, pain point analysis, solution generation, and finally, evaluation and measurement.

Step 1

Clarifying Questions

  • Looking at the product context, I'm thinking SystemOne might be targeting a diverse user base with varying levels of data literacy. Could you help me understand who our primary users are and their typical use cases?

Why it matters: This will help us tailor the UI improvements to the needs of our core users. Expected answer: Data analysts and business intelligence professionals in mid to large enterprises. Impact on approach: If confirmed, we'd focus on advanced features and efficiency for power users.

  • Considering user behavior, I'm curious about how users typically interact with the tool. Are they primarily using it for creating one-off visualizations, or are they building and maintaining ongoing dashboards?

Why it matters: This will influence whether we prioritize quick, intuitive creation or robust management features. Expected answer: A mix of both, with a trend towards more ongoing dashboard management. Impact on approach: We'd need to balance ease of use for quick visualizations with powerful features for dashboard management.

  • Thinking about the product lifecycle, where does SystemOne currently stand in the market, and what are the key metrics driving this improvement initiative?

Why it matters: This helps us understand if we should focus on acquisition, retention, or monetization. Expected answer: Established player, but facing increased competition. Focusing on user retention and engagement. Impact on approach: We'd prioritize features that increase stickiness and user satisfaction over flashy new capabilities.

  • Considering external factors, how has the competitive landscape evolved recently, and are there any emerging user needs or expectations we should be aware of?

Why it matters: This helps us ensure our improvements are forward-looking and competitive. Expected answer: Increased demand for AI-assisted insights and mobile-friendly interfaces. Impact on approach: We'd look to incorporate AI-driven features and ensure responsive design in our improvements.
